Pennsylvania Association Of Non Profit Homes For The Aging
| Fiscal year | Revenue | Expenses | Net | Reserve mo. | Staff % |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2011 | 3,519,565 | 2,946,775 | 572,790 | 24.7 | 32% |
| 2012 | 3,751,737 | 3,047,984 | 703,753 | 27.2 | 31% |
| 2013 | 3,949,411 | 3,562,150 | 387,261 | 25.1 | 32% |
| 2014 | 4,292,524 | 3,504,548 | 787,976 | 26.7 | 34% |
| 2015 | 3,871,283 | 4,136,021 | −264,738 | 21.1 | 37% |
| 2016 | 1,426,060 | 2,007,883 | −581,823 | 41.2 | 33% |
| 2017 | 1,054,166 | 900,283 | 153,883 | 93.8 | 0% |
| 2018 | 280,515 | 277,090 | 3,425 | 237.2 | 0% |
| 2019 | 1,153,263 | 1,391,647 | −238,384 | 51.0 | 0% |
| 2020 | 477,383 | 830,537 | −353,154 | 87.3 | 0% |
| 2021 | 785,726 | 1,061,508 | −275,782 | 67.5 | 0% |
| 2022 | 1,079,655 | 1,428,670 | −349,015 | 39.2 | 0% |
| 2023 | 1,078,094 | 1,539,216 | −461,122 | 36.3 | 0% |
In its most recent public year (2023), this organization spent $461,122 more than it brought in. Its reserves stood at about 36.3 months of spending, up from 24.7 in 2011. Staff pay was 0% of spending. $22,154 of its net assets are donor-restricted.
Reserve months = net assets ÷ average monthly spending; net assets count everything the organization owns beyond its debts — buildings and donor-restricted funds included, not just cash. Staff pay = salaries, wages, and officer compensation; it excludes benefits and payroll taxes. The IRS releases this data years after the fact — this organization's newest public year is 2023.
